Accessing and Managing Your Personal Information

Roobet India grants registered users specific rights over stored personal data. Account holders can access stored records, correct inaccurate details, delete information within regulatory limits, restrict certain processing activities, object to marketing uses and request data portability to another service. Account dashboards provide direct tools for data exports and preference changes, and support channels handle formal requests for access, correction or deletion actions through secure messaging systems.

  1. Accessing stored records. Log in to the account dashboard and locate the data access request form under privacy settings;
  2. Requesting corrections. Submit updated information through the secure inbox when account details become outdated or inaccurate;
  3. Deleting personal data. Send a deletion request via support channels and confirm identity to start the removal process;
  4. Restricting processing. Adjust privacy settings to limit how usage data gets processed for analytics or marketing purposes;
  5. Objecting to marketing. Disable marketing communications through preference controls available in account settings sections;
  6. Requesting portability. Contact support to export stored personal data in structured formats for transfer to another platform.

Protection of Minors

Roobet Privacy Policy India confirms that casino services target adults exclusively and restrict access to users aged eighteen years or older. Registration forms request date of birth for initial age screening, and subsequent verification procedures confirm submitted identity documents against minimum age thresholds. Accounts discovered to belong to minors face immediate closure, and deposited funds return following standard withdrawal verification protocols.

Data retention and account closure

Roobet stores personal information for different periods after account closure to satisfy regulatory demands and support record-keeping standards. The Roobet Privacy Policy India framework determines how long identity documents, payment transactions, technical session data and messaging archives remain accessible in secure systems. Retention schedules protect both compliance needs and user privacy across all stored categories.

Data categoryRetention period
Identity documents and verification recordsUp to 10 years after account closure
Transaction records and payment history7 years from the date of last transaction
Technical logs and session data2 years from collection date
Communication history and support tickets3 years from last message sent
